Output 59b5431be548d08582439b4eb31bbe4b17ac93f5d9bc3e67d4c97ea3b3e6ce4d:0

value
2600000
script pubkey
OP_0 OP_PUSHBYTES_20 fcc4f5f08c2003e1beb864a6e14324ea302ba7c2
address
bc1qlnz0tuyvyqp7r04cvjnwzseyagczhf7zu8772f
transaction
59b5431be548d08582439b4eb31bbe4b17ac93f5d9bc3e67d4c97ea3b3e6ce4d
confirmations
174469
spent
true